Sugar Learning Environment, Activity Toolkit, GTK 3.
screenshots on user-initiated activity save and close. Check before saving that the window is not fully obscured, as it might be if the user initiates the close from the frame--- this would produce incorrect screenshots. The check for visibility is done by attaching a handler to the Activity class which handles visibility-notify-events from X. In the sugar repository equivalent changes remove automated screenshot acquisition from window manager navigation events (e.g. tabbing). |

Sugar is the core of the OLPC Human Interface. The toolkit provides a set of widgets to build HIG compliant applications and interfaces to interact with system services like presence and the datastore.
